Netflix Confirms ‘KYLIE,’ a Three-Part Kylie Minogue Documentary

The project signals Netflix’s continued push into archival-led portraits of global music stars.

Overview

  • Netflix, which announced the series Wednesday with a first-look image, said KYLIE will unfold across three episodes.
  • Kylie Minogue opens her personal archives, drawing on home movies, personal photographs, and new interviews to reveal the person behind the hits.
  • Emmy- and BAFTA-winning filmmaker Michael Harte directs, with John Battsek’s Ventureland producing after recent Netflix projects like Beckham and Wham!.
  • Friends, family, and collaborators appear, including Dannii Minogue, Jason Donovan, Nick Cave, and Pete Waterman, as the doc explores her responses to public scrutiny, personal loss, and illness, including her 2005 breast cancer.
  • Netflix has not announced a release date or trailer, and the series sits on the streamer’s 2026 slate for now.
